Stacey and Justin's Wedding Day

Stacey and Justin were married on Saturday 31st July at the gorgeous Mitton Hall.
Beginning at the Dunkenhalgh Hotel in the morning I captured the preparations and was surprised to find things running so smoothly and calmly, there seemed to be a very peaceful atmosphere and everyone was soon ready to leave. The wedding car collected the bridesmaids first who I soon followed up to Mitton Hall to meet the second photographer, Charlie, who had been with the Justin and the men as they prepared.
The weather was a little touch and go but seemed to be starting to clear as we all waited for Stacey to arrive. We waited .... still no sign of the wedding car. The wedding car had gotten a puncture on the way and was on the side of the road about 5 minutes away where the driver was hurriedly trying to change the tyre.
It wasn't too much longer though when the car appeared on the driveway and we were all pleasantly surprised to see a still smiling Stacey get out - obviously nothing fases her!

A lovely ceremony where the couple had written their own vows was followed by drinks and canapes outside in the sunshine whilst the photos were taken. They decided not to go for a drive in the wedding car afterwards - didn't want to tempt fate a second time!

A brightly coloured bouncy castle was up on the lawns at the back of the hall which provided some fun shots of Stacey and her bridesmaids jumping around and the gorgeous grounds offered some stunning backdrops for the intimate shots of the bride and groom.

A very tasty meal was had by all followed by the fun and laughter of the speeches before the evening guests started to arrive and the party truly began with Stacey and Justins first dance. Messages were recorded for the happy couple by the videographers - Abbey Video.

We ended our coverage with shots of 50 chinese lanterns being set off on the back lawns of Mitton Hall as the couple watched them float up into the air and over the building. This was a fantastic day for all and we wish Stacey and Justin all the best for the future.

Louise and Garys' Wedding

A nice local wedding for Louise and Gary on Saturday 17th July 2010. Very local infact as the brides house is within sight of my own front door - no worrying about where to park!

The weather, unfortunately was not the best - we all spent the morning watching for the promised clearing of the rain, but alas although it held off for a short time the heavens opened again after the ceremony at Mere Hall in Bolton. The original plan had been to stop at a local park for some pics of the happy couple but when the passing shower didn't pass we decided to head straight over to the Reebok Stadium for the reception - typically as soon as we arrived it stopped raining!!!

The sun came out bright and warm for a few shots with the car at the hotel entrance and allowed us enough time to get some lovely pics of Louise and Gary. The rest of the afternoon was spent dodging the showers whilst waiting to go down for some bridal party shots on the hallowed turf of BWFC.

An informal drinks reception followed by the arrival of the evening guests and the first dance before the buffet and everyone had a great day despite the rain - which cleared off for the late afternoon and evening.
